Another setback: Lautaro Martinez leaves Argentina national team camp

During the current international break, the Argentina national team will face Uruguay and Brazil, and today they've lost yet another key player.
Inter Milan striker Lautaro Martinez has officially left the Argentina national team camp. He arrived with muscle discomfort, and the medical staff decided that he will miss both matches.
Initially, it was assumed that Lautaro would only miss the match against Uruguay, but now he has been forced to leave the Argentina camp entirely.
Previously, the legendary Lionel Messi was also excluded from the Argentina squad. Roma forward Paulo Dybala couldn't join the team either.
Scaloni and his coaching staff will decide in the coming hours who will replace Lautaro Martinez in the team. With Julian Alvarez and Nicolas Gonzalez almost guaranteed in the coach's scheme, the potential replacement for Martinez could fall to one of the called-up forwards: Angel Correa or Thiago Almada.
Nevertheless, young talents Claudio Echeverri and Santiago Castro, who are also on the list, might be considered for this role.
